The sharpei chair in that second picture I am NOT a fan of but it is the “Grinza” chair by Fernando and Humberto Campana for Edra.

HOWEVER, the flower chair in the first picture I am a fan of because it is the iconic “Getsuen” chair by Masanori Umeda for Edra. He also designed a bunch of stuff for Memphis Milano. I absolutely hate that it’s styled in that boring all white interior.
